Claimant Will Serve Prison Time for Altering Report

Thursday, July 13, 2006 | 0

A claimant who altered a doctor's medical report to receive workers' compensation benefits was sentenced to two to four years in state prison this week, the state Attorney General Tom Corbett announced in a press release. Kenneth L. Knight, 47, of Greensburg, Penn., was found guilty on all charges of insurance fraud, criminal attempt and forgery after a jury trial last April. Knight was sentenced by Westmoreland County Judge John Blahovec.
